RAWALPINDI, Feb 3: Police arrested 5, including assistant superintendent of Central jail Adiala, assistant sub-inspector of police and two other jail employees, on Saturday, while they were gambling near the heavily guarded jail, said police officials.

Police are still trying to arrest a constable who managed to escape from the scene, during the police raid.

The police, acting on a tip-off raided the spot near the jail, where six persons — Jamshaid Nawaz, Basharat Masih, Ashraf Masih, Abdul Hameed Bhatti, Hafeez Ullah and Zahid Mehmood — were caught red-handed while playing cards and using cash.

One of them — Abdul Hameed Bhatti — posted as assistant superintendent at Central Jail Adiala had been a senior staff member of the jail, who was retiring in March.

Assistant sub-inspector (ASI) Hafeez ullah and constable Zahid Mehmood had been associated with Rawalpindi police and were presently posted at Police Lines Rawalpindi.

The two others, Basharat Masih and Ashraf Masih, were also employees at the jail.

Police seized Rs7,500, four cell phones, cards and registered a case against the six persons under the gambling act.

When contacted, the jail superintendent Malik Mushtaq confirmed the police raid and arrest of a senior member of jail staff in connection with gambling.

“It has been a common practice that some people gamble, after getting their salary,” said the superintendent jail.

“Unluckily, a senior assistant superintendent of our jail was also caught during the police raid,” said Malik Mushtaq, adding that he tired to stop him from gambling as his retirement was approaching but he did not listen.

The Saddar Barooni police registered a case against the six people and started investigation.
